A » Automation can indeed enhance sleep quality by regulating breathing patterns. Smart devices, such as sleep trackers and smart speakers, can guide users through breathing exercises that promote relaxation. By automating these routines, users can establish consistent practices that help in reducing anxiety and improving sleep. Incorporating personalized feedback, these technologies can adjust routines to better suit individual needs, leading to more effective sleep improvement over time.

A »Yes, automation can guide better sleep through breathing control. Devices can regulate airflow, monitor breathing patterns, and adjust settings to promote relaxation, helping users achieve a restful sleep. Some smart home systems integrate breathing exercises and calming ambiance to improve sleep quality.
